THE NEW ALBUM

DARK DAYS EP

The Dark Days EP was recorded in Memphis with Grammy nominated producer Justin Rimer, formerly with the band 12 Stones.  Lead vocalist Buster Grant and bassist Rob Ferebee, a former long-time lead vocalist of Freakhouse, collaborated with Justin and several talented studio musicians to bring this EP to life.

​

As Buster and Rob put the Livin' Dark Daze lineup together they were met with no shortage of challenges.  "Each of the songs on this album take a special level of musicianship", says Buster, "and you can't just get anyone in town to pull it off.  This is the highest level of studio talent in the country and we've got to find that same level of talent in our hometown."

​

Buster had already recruited his long-time bandmate Albert Arguelles on guitar to pair with Rob.  A number of others had short tenure until the decision was made to add two more guitarists.  Chris Cabello and Justin Ervine were added to the lineup having solid stage experience and the sheer talent needed to fill out the massive sound LDD is known for.

​

The final gap was a drummer that could mimic the likes of some of the best talent in Memphis having worked with the best on the EP.  Justin approached David McGilvrey, ex-Deathdodger and current alternate for Even In Death, about the gig.  David quickly recorded a playthrough and the current lineup was solidified.

​

The band is working on new material being self produced at the studio of drummer David McGilvrey, who has been a long time producer working with the likes of The Crowned, Even In Death, Suicide Silence, among others.
